50 77 STREET
50 77 STREET is a Class A5 (one-family attached) building in Brooklyn (BBL 3059570017) built in 1925, with 1 residential unit across 2 floors.
The building is in NYC community district 310, council district 47, zoning district R3-1, on a 2,187-square-foot lot with a building footprint of 1,276 square feet.
The current registered owner of record per NYC PLUTO is REILLY, JOHN.
The most recent ACRIS deed transfer for this BBL was recorded on May 9, 2022 when SAVARESE, MONICA; SAVARESE, JOHN conveyed the property to REILLY, JOHN; LAGNESE, JONATHAN for $1.19M. The transaction was recorded as cash (no paired mortgage instrument).

What is the assessed value of 50 77 STREET?
NYC Department of Finance assesses 50 77 STREET at $69K for the current tax year. NYC assesses property at a fraction of estimated market value (the assessment ratio varies by tax class — 6% for tax class 1 one-to-three-family dwellings, approximately 45% for tax class 2 rental apartment buildings), so the market value implied by this assessment is meaningfully higher. Assessment data is published by NYC Department of Finance.
